From: 'Nel' on 31 Jul 2010 17:17 From BBC..... Sunderland midfielder Kieran Richardson has signed a new three-year contract which will keep him on Wearside until the summer of 2013. The 25-year-old has scored eight goals in 85 games for the Black Cats. Former Sunderland manager Roy Keane signed Richardson for �5.5m in 2007 from Manchester United, where he made 81 appearances in five years. Richardson showed his versatility by briefly playing at left-back under Sunderland's ***previous*** boss Steve Bruce. Blimey!!
